The Acolaid Suite is a corporate information management system that is designed to transform service delivery and performance. Advocating collaborative working, Acolaid allows local authorities to share a corporate pool of street, land and property information.
Derived from a single development source, Acolaid comprises a fully integrated suite of systems that cover core property based services in Environmental Health, Planning, Development Plans, Building Control, Land Charges and Development Plans. As a result of this integrated approach, councils can save the time, money and effort that is often wasted in duplicated information, and avoid the hassle of transferring information between departments.
Data is of little use unless it can be shared widely, benefiting all those who have a need for key land and property information. Acolaid was designed with integration in mind to facilitate the widest possible interaction with third party datasets. Using XML technology, Acolaid can integrate with a range of CRM systems, GIS systems, DIP systems, relational databases and legacy systems.
